Output d78975887bf99852095cab9d036c0cf6e9e527b4eb3dbf52d0455d2d01afb5f6:2

value
26414066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c7925d7718eb4ffa5035ae503068937582a4518 OP_EQUAL
address
3Baa2m1376dfvfR8mmUHtRL9tz99wSvoFG
transaction
d78975887bf99852095cab9d036c0cf6e9e527b4eb3dbf52d0455d2d01afb5f6
spent
true